Thinking in systems, their interactions, feedback-cycles and causal dependencies is a very important and underdeveloped skill for any person, regardless of profession, since we all live and have to make decisions in an increasingly messy/complex/interactive environment. I believe second/nth-order thinking can help with that.
From my personal experience I can recommend the free online course “Introduction to Complexity” since it helped me develop a better understanding and intuition about these things: https://www.complexityexplorer.org/courses/144-introduction-to-complexity https://www.complexityexplorer.org/courses/144-introduction-... and also the book “The Art of interconnected thinking” from Frederic Vester (I am not sure if this is the correct translation, the German title is: “Die Kunst vernetzt zu denken”). But there are of course many other great resources to learn about complexity and systems thinking.
It is also increasingly important to think beyond our own (ideological, disciplinary, conditioned, etc.) “tunnel”, because many problems in the real world have multiple dimensions to them, just like there is not only black and white, not only grayscale, but all the colours of the rainbow. It is convenient to stay in one dimension (e.g. our own profession, a paradigm/worldview, a conceptual framework) because it makes us feel confident and secure. Often we can afford to do so if the implications of our decisions stay within the boundaries of our “tunnel”. But this is most often not the case in complex environments and being ignorant about those other dimensions can lead to miscommunication and failure to address the concerns of our clients, relationships, etc. So I would recommend not only nth-order thinking, but also multi-dimensional thinking (which may be included in the former, but should be emphasized more strongly I believe).
